What do Airbnb hosts actually earn in Bridgeport?

Bridgeport hosts earn a median $10,723/year with $81 ADR and 66% occupancy.

Top performers pull in $21,778+ per year.

Overview of Bridgeport

Bridgeport is a village in eastern Belmont County, Ohio, United States. It lies across the Ohio River from Wheeling, West Virginia, at the mouth of Wheeling Creek and is connected by two bridges to Wheeling Island. The population was 1,582 at the 2020 census. It is part of the Wheeling metropolitan area.
